Output 7643cd7181046201996deed65718f3202136df7f50085ca7dde8a82a8050c90f:1

value
20639131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 231922ace3f0ee408ca2424411cab99ea0b13867 OP_EQUAL
address
34tbghXWwGJni9WK3vQ8pM52wJXzF8qgyv
transaction
7643cd7181046201996deed65718f3202136df7f50085ca7dde8a82a8050c90f
confirmations
346668
spent
true